Princeton Named Best Place To Live In New Jersey

Niche.com graded which towns are the best to live in New Jersey on its "report card" based on an A+-to-D- scale.

PRINCETON, NJ — Congrats Princeton residents! Princeton has been named as the number one best place to live in New Jersey for 2020, according to Niche.com's latest "report card".

Data compiler Niche assigned a grade, on an A+-to-D- scale, to almost every town in the state for its 2020 rankings of the "Best Places to Live" in New Jersey. It took several factors into consideration, such as the quality of local schools, crime rates, housing trends, employment statistics, and access to amenities.

Princeton received an overall Niche grade of A+. Here's how Niche graded Princeton in the following categories:

  • Public Schools: A+
  • Crime & Safety: B
  • Housing: C+
  • Nightlife: A
  • Good for Families: A+
  • Diversity: A-
  • Jobs: B+
  • Weather: B-
  • Cost of Living: C-
  • Health & Fitness: A
  • Outdoor Activities: A
  • Commute: A+

The top 10 best places to live in New Jersey are:

  1. Princeton
  2. Princeton Junction
  3. Upper Montclair
  4. Ridgewood
  5. Mountain Lakes
  6. Princeton Meadows
  7. Springdale
  8. Monmouth Junction
  9. Westfield
  10. New Providence
